 Clouds of Corona virus are continuously floating everywhere. Since the origin of Covid-19, it has already affected over 2.4 crore people in India with over 2.6 lakh deaths. Also in Goa more than 1.3 lakh cases are reported till date with more than 1800 deaths. Bodies are ‘laid to rest’. People are not even allowed to attend their funeral for a compassionate act of a handful of mud: “ghalunk ek nodor moddeak anik Korunk iek doiall kornni meloleak divun ek mutt bor mati”.
Many have lost their parents, close relatives, blood relations and some are left as orphan children with tears rolling down their eyes. Priests, nuns, doctors, nurses have gone never to roam on this globe again. No job, no work, no money; heavy hours hanging on one’s hands. We all know that there has been a ceaseless rise in the number of Corona virus cases. Lockdowns are delaying money-making recovery. Lockdown is just creating hardships for the business world.
Therefore, we have to live with Covid-19. Its second wave is not yet over and its third wave is on the way. We have to observe the ‘standard operating procedure’. We have to wear the face masks which have now become part of our obligatory dress code; maintain social distancing at our workplace; and last but not the least that we can do is continuously test people to quarantine the infected; away from others, so they don’t unknowingly infect anyone in their vicinity.
